Most professionals agree upon the fact that it isn’t the act of reading in the dark itself that … WebApr 11, 2024 · Yes, it can—reading in the dark or in dim light can cause eye strain. And this can sometimes “hurt,” meaning it can cause soreness or other uncomfortable symptoms. Eye strain can also affect your sight while you’re experiencing it. Fortunately, eye strain is temporary and won’t injure your eyes in any lasting way. open source software syllabus jntuk

WebJul 4, 2006 · The misconception of reading in the dark is widely spread in American culture. Most professionals agree upon the fact that it isn’t the act of reading in the dark itself that damages the eyes but rather that reading in the dark can cause eye strain, also known as eye fatigue.
